Transaction 648976f7674bea79f9cac9656e8456e0b0e212cd159f85aeb815c8e04f2e7918

1 Input
1 Outputs
  • 648976f7674bea79f9cac9656e8456e0b0e212cd159f85aeb815c8e04f2e7918:0
  • value  26156475
    address  3EQVhcU9HaEmBJ7Fbj6mhEGhJPNjJFpD4U